互联网生活知识分享 常识分享 ddl是什么意思(ddl的具体意思是什么)

ddl是什么意思(ddl的具体意思是什么)

ddl是什么意思,在计算机技术中,DDL是一个常用的缩写,它代表的是“Data Definition Language”,即数据定义语言的意思。DDL是一种用于定义和管理数据库中的数据结构的语言,它包括创建、修改和删除数据库的各种对象,例如表、视图、索引、存储过程等。

ddl是什么意思

DDL通常由数据库管理系统提供的特定命令组成,它们负责实现数据库的结构定义和控制,包括各种数据库对象的创建、修改和删除。通过使用DDL,开发人员可以轻松地创建和管理数据库,确保数据的完整性和一致性。

下面我们来详细了解一下DDL的具体含义及其在数据库管理中的应用。

1. 数据库对象的创建

ddl是什么意思(ddl的具体意思是什么)

DDL的一个主要功能是用于创建数据库中的各种对象。例如,通过使用CREATE TABLE命令,我们可以创建一个新的数据库表。这个命令包括表的名称、字段以及每个字段的数据类型和约束条件等。

同样,我们也可以使用CREATE VIEW命令创建一个虚拟表,它是基于一个或多个现有表的查询结果集。通过使用CREATE INDEX命令,我们可以为表的一个或多个列创建索引,以提高查询效率。

2. 数据库对象的修改

除了创建对象,DDL也可以用于修改数据库中的对象。例如,我们可以使用ALTER TABLE命令来修改表的结构。通过ALTER TABLE,我们可以添加新的列、修改现有列的数据类型或约束条件,还可以删除列或修改表的名称。

类似地,我们可以使用ALTER VIEW命令修改虚拟表的定义。通过ALTER INDEX命令,我们可以修改索引的定义,包括添加或删除索引的列。

3. 数据库对象的删除

DDL还可以用于删除数据库中的对象。例如,通过使用DROP TABLE命令,我们可以删除一个表及其所有数据和约束条件。同样,DROP VIEW命令用于删除一个虚拟表,而DROP INDEX命令用于删除一个索引。

4. 应用DDL的注意事项

在使用DDL的过程中,有一些注意事项需要我们注意:

1、DDL语句一旦执行,将直接对数据库结构进行修改,所以在执行之前请务必备份数据,以防止数据的丢失。

2、当我们创建或修改数据库对象时,应该遵循良好的命名规范,以确保对象的唯一性和易于理解。

3、在对数据库对象进行修改或删除之前,请务必确保没有其他对象依赖于它们,否则可能会导致运行时错误。

4、对于复杂的数据库结构修改,建议在非生产环境中进行测试和验证,以确保修改的正确性和稳定性。

总结

ddl是什么意思,在数据库管理中,DDL是一个重要的工具,用于定义和控制数据库中的数据结构。通过使用DDL,我们可以轻松地创建、修改和删除数据库对象,确保数据的完整性和一致性。然而,在使用DDL的过程中,我们需要注意一些事项,以避免可能的错误和问题。

免责声明:文章内容来源于网络,不代表本站立场,本站不对其内容的真实性、完整性、准确性给予任何担保、暗示和承诺,严禁浏览者根据内容形成判断与决定,浏览者所做的任何判断与决定与本文无关,本文也无任何商业盈利目的。
返回顶部